单词 disdainful
释义

disdainfuladj.

/dɪsˈdeɪnfʊl/
Etymology: < disdain n. + -ful suffix.
1.
a. Full of or showing disdain; scornful, contemptuous, proudly disregardful.

a1542 T. Wyatt Coll. Poems (1969) lvi. 9 Vnder disdaynfull browe.
a1616 W. Shakespeare As you like It (1623) iii. iv. 45 The proud disdainfull Shepherdesse That was his Mistresse. View more context for this quotation
1663 A. Cowley Ode on his Majesty's Restauration xii Cast a disdainful look behind.
1751 T. Gray Elegy viii. 6 Nor [let] Grandeur hear with a disdainful smile, The short and simple annals of the poor.
1849 T. B. Macaulay Hist. Eng. I. 122 They..marched against the most renowned battalions of Europe with disdainful confidence.
b. Const. infinitive or of.
ΚΠ
1580 J. Lyly Euphues & his Eng. (new ed.) f. 115v Yet are they..not disdainefull to conferre.
1623 W. Shakespeare & J. Fletcher Henry VIII ii. iv. 121 Stubborne to Iustice..Disdainfull to be tride by't. View more context for this quotation
1746 T. Morell Judas Maccabæus Disdainful of danger, we'll rush on the foe.
1874 J. R. Green Short Hist. Eng. People viii. §5. 505 An administrator, disdainful of private ends.
2. Indignant, displeased; inimical. Obsolete. rare.

1548 Hall's Vnion: Richard III f. xlvv The malicious attemptes and disdeynfull inuencions of his enuious aduersaries.
1550 M. Coverdale tr. O. Werdmueller Spyrytuall & Precyouse Pearle xii. sig. Fvj Vexed in hys mynde, and dysdaynefull that he is not so..fortunate as other.
3. That is the object of indignation, hateful; that is the object of disdain. Obsolete.

a1547 Earl of Surrey tr. Virgil Certain Bks. Aenæis (1557) ii. sig. Civ For I my yeres disdainfull to the Gods [L. invisus divis] Haue lingred fourth.
1590 C. Marlowe Tamburlaine: 1st Pt. sig. D3v Villaine..Fall prostrate on the lowe disdainefull earth.
